Cercis canadensis ‘Forest Pansy’, commonly known as Forest Pansy Redbud, is a beautiful deciduous small tree prized for its vibrant purple foliage, rosy-pink spring flowers, and graceful branching habit. This popular redbud cultivar is an excellent choice for specimen planting, woodland gardens, residential landscapes, borders, and naturalized settings.
In early spring, Cercis canadensis ‘Forest Pansy’ produces abundant clusters of rosy-pink to magenta flowers that emerge directly along the branches and trunk before the foliage appears. These distinctive blooms provide an early-season display and attract bees, butterflies, and other pollinators. As the flowers fade, heart-shaped leaves emerge in rich shades of burgundy and deep purple, creating striking contrast throughout the growing season.
Forest Pansy Redbud performs best in full sun to partial shade and prefers moist, well-drained soil. Once established, it is relatively low maintenance and adapts well to a variety of landscape conditions. Its moderate size and ornamental features make it a versatile choice for smaller landscapes where a flowering ornamental tree with multi-season interest is desired.
